Mac下, Android Studio中獲取SHA1和MD5, keytool 錯誤: java.lang.Exception: 密鑰庫文件不存在:

打開Android Studio中的Terminal,也可以直接打開系統的

獲取debug.keystore的SHA1和MD5

keytool -list -v -keystore ~/.android/debug.keystore -alias androiddebugkey -storepass android -keypass android

獲取其他keystore的,如正式簽名文件的

keytool -list -v -keystore ~/你的路徑/xxx.keystore -alias aaa -storepass bbb -keypass ccc

需要把路徑和密碼改成相應的就可以了

aaa - 填寫你的keyAlias
bbb - 填寫你的storePassword
ccc - 填寫你的keyPassword

你的路徑:

是一個相對路徑,不是絕對路徑。否則,會報錯:
keytool 錯誤: java.lang.Exception: 密鑰庫文件不存在

例如:

keytool -list -v -keystore ~/Desktop/app.keystore -alias test -storepass 123456 -keypass 123456

keyAlias:test
storePassword :123456
keyPassword:123456

發表評論
所有評論
還沒有人評論,想成為第一個評論的人麼? 請在上方評論欄輸入並且點擊發布.
相關文章